Set up an LLC. You are probably fine, but just in case, you want to be able to insulate your personal liability to any potential Nintendo legal issues that could arise. Or just any legal issues, really. The LLC makes it so, if you get sued, it's the business and not just you and your brother. But congrats, for real! This is really cool.
This is probably the best piece of advice here.
Once you set up LLC put put equipment , supplies , everything in the biz. Get a bluevine or other biz checking acct with card. And move it out if your house and into a small storage unit some where. Maybe not right away but soon, I feel you need to really insulate personal property from biz property due to possible kickback from Nintendo. And for the love of God don’t use their name in your name. You will have cease and desist letters in no time if you do.
